#741e34 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#741e34 is composed of 45.5% red, 11.8%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.1% magenta, 55.2%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 344.7 degrees, a saturation of 58.9% and a lightness of 28.6%. #741e34 color hex could be obtained by blending #e83c68 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#741e34

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070203 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#741e34

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4547 is the less saturated color, while #900226 is the most saturated one.
